Senators acquire Ryan Shannon
IllegalCurve.com —
... acquired one today.
Murray dealt little-used defenseman Lawrence Nycholat to the Vancouver Canucks in exchange for 25-year-old forward Ryan Shannon.
With this move it appears Murray won’t be interested in UFA forwards Mark Parrish and Glen Murray. Shannon has only seen limited action in two NHL seasons split between Anaheim and Vancouver, although he did play in 11 playoff games with the Ducks during their Cup run in 2007.
